Lucky Saint (Soho): Darts in London
Lucky Saint is the alcohol-free brewery's own pub on Devonshire Street, just up from Great Portland Street station on the Marylebone and Fitzrovia border. It opened in 2023 in the old Masons Arms, and it pours Lucky Saint's 0.5% lager alongside a proper drinks list that still covers full-strength beer, wine and spirits, so it works whether or not you're drinking. The single dart board sits on the right-hand side of the bar. There's no oche to book and no charge to play, you just wait for it to clear and have a throw, which the regulars are happy to share. Come for an easy after-work session with a few mates, decent pub classics off a short menu, and the rare option of a big night out that doesn't have to involve alcohol.

The darts setup
Keep it simple here: there's a single board mounted on the right-hand side of the bar, the kind of casual pub setup where you chalk up between rounds rather than booking a slot. It's a traditional board, not an automatic-scoring oche, so bring your own marker app or a pen. Most of the time you can wander over and get a throw, though it can fill up when the pub is busy in the evening. This isn't a multi-board darts hall, it's a friendly corner pub that happens to have a board, so treat it as a relaxed game with your pint rather than a structured competition.

Getting there
The pub sits at 58 Devonshire Street on the quiet edge between Marylebone and Fitzrovia. Great Portland Street station is the closest stop, roughly 200 metres away on the Circle, Hammersmith and City, and Metropolitan lines, so it's an easy walk from the platform. Regent's Park station on the Bakerloo line is also within reach, and Oxford Circus is a short stroll south if you're coming from the shops. The street itself is residential and calm, a bit off the main drag, which is part of the appeal once you're inside with a board free and a pint in hand.
